Abstract

An ultrasonic transducer for medical imaging was presented. It combined electromechanical and optical properties of PZN-PT single crystal. A thin layer of active material served both as transmitter and receiver of ultrasound. An intrinsic interferometer was formed by the thin layer by a partially reflective mirror/electrode on one side and a fully reflective mirror/electrode on other side.
